I'm not obsessed with Nora, not exactly. I've been intrigued and a bit enamored by her ability to create and consistently grow as a powerhouse. Who wouldn't want to be Nora right now? Recently, she's been involved with MyLifetime.com. Her books have been developed into the Nora Roberts 2009 Collection...It's basically four of her books made for television. I've seen past adaptations of Blue Smoke, Angel Falls, Carolina Moon and Montana Sky, and although they were not the best adaptations, they were charming--and I watched them all while stuffing my face with buttered popcorn and chasing them down with hard liquor.

This time around, I was interested in seeing if the production value went up. After watching Jane Porter's FLIRTING WITH FORTY, I was hoping that they would be vastly improved. To my surprise, they were. These book adaptations include: Northern Lights, Midnight Bayou, High Noon, and Tribute. Only 2 of the four have already shown. These movies are supposed to run 4 Saturdays in a row and I've caught the first two on the www.mylifetime.com website since I don't have cable. I'll be honest, I was extremely engaged in Midnight Bayou. I thought it was very well scripted and rounded off with a good cast. The whole supernatural/reincarnation element was a plus. Sure, I've gotten sucked in by Nora...and although I still haven't read more than a handful of her books...I'm very pleased. It makes me aspire to be like her.
